计算机系统结构学习笔记.pdfV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第一章 计算机系统结构的基本概念 1.1计算机系统的多级层次结构 1、由高到低分6级 虚拟机器: M5:应用语言级。经应用程序包翻译成高级语言程序; M4 :高级语言级。经编译程序翻译成汇编语言、中间语言 程序、机器语言程序。 M3 :汇编语言级。经汇编程序翻译成机器语言程序。 M2 :操作系统级。用机器语言程序解释作业控制语句。 实际机器: M 1:传统机器语言级。用微指令解释机器指令。 M0 :微程序级。由硬件直接执行微指令。 2、机器——被定义为能存储和执行相应语言程序和数据结构的集 合体。 3、翻译——是先用转换程序将高一级的机器级的程序整个地变换 成低一级机器级上等效的程序,然后再在低一级机器级上实现的技术。 4、解释——在低级机器级上用它的一串语句或指令来仿真高级机 器级上的一条语句或指令的功能,通过高级机器语言程序中的每条语句 或指令逐条解释来实现的技术。 5、虚拟机器不一定由软件实现,有些操作也可以用软硬件或硬件 实现。 6、软件和硬件在逻辑功能上是等效的,只是性能、价格、实现的 难易程序不同。在满足应用的前提下,主要是看能否充分利用硬、器件 技术的进展,使系统有较高的性价比。因此,采用何种方式实现,就 从系统的效率、速度、造价、资源状况等多方面考虑,对软件、硬 件、固件取舍进行综合平衡。 7、计算机看成层次结构推动了计算机系统结构的发展: 可以重新调整软、硬件比例,充分利用更多、更好的硬件支持,改 变硬、器件迅速发展而软件 日益复杂、开销过大的状况; 可以将各虚拟机用真正的实处理机代替,摆脱各级功能都在同一台 实机器上实现的状况,发展多处理机、分布处理、计算机网; 可以在一台宿主机上模拟或仿真另一台机器,推动自虚拟机、多种 操作系统共行等技术的应用,从而促进软件移植、计算机性能评价、计 算机设计自动化等的发展。 1.2计算机系统结构、组成与实现 1、系统结构——是对计算机系统中各级界面的划分、定义及其上 下功能的分配。 2 、透明——客观存在事物或属性从某个角度看不到,称对他透 明。 3、计算机系统结构 (计算机体系统结构)——它只是系统结构中 的一部分,指的是传统机器级的系统结构。其界面之上包括操作系统、 汇编语言、高级语言级和应用语言级中所有软件功能,界面之下包括所 有硬件和固件的功能。因此,它是软件和硬件的交界面,是机器语言、 汇编语言程序、编译程序设计者看到的机器物理系统抽象。计算机系统 结构研究的是软、硬件之间的功能划分以及对传统机器级界面的确定, 提供机器语言、汇编语言、编译程序程序设计者为使其设计的系统能在 机器上正确运行应看到和遵守的计算机属性。 4 、机器级内部的数据流、控制流的组成,逻辑设计和器件设计等 都不包含在计算机系统结构中。 5、计算机组成——是计算机系统的逻辑实现,包括机器级内的数 据流和控制流的组成和逻辑设计等。它着眼于机器级内部各事件的排序 方式与控制机构、各部件的功能及各部件的联系。计算机组成设计要解 决的问题是,在达到所希望的性能、价格下,如何更好地把各种设备和 部件组织成计算机,来实现所确定的系统结构。 6、计算机实现——是指计算机组成的物理实现,它着眼于器件技 术和微组装技术。其中,器件技术在实现技术中起着主导作用。 7、设计何种系列机发球计算机系统结构,而系列机内不同型号计 算机的组织属于计算机组成。 8、结合型通道——让通道的功能借用中央处理机的某些部件完 成。同一套硬件分时执行中央处理机和通道的功能。速度低、成本低。 9、独立型通道——通道单独设置硬件,与中央处理机并行,成本 高、速度高。 10、计算机系统结构、组成、实现的相互影响: 相同结构的计算机,可以采用不同的组成,一种组成可以有不同的 实现。 不同的结构可能采用不同的组成技术,组成反过来也影响结构,如 果没有组成技术的进步,结构进展是不可能的。 结构设计必须结合应用考虑,为软件和算法的实现提供更多更好的 支持,同时要考虑可能采用和准备采用的组成技术。结构设计应尽可能 避免过多地或不合理地限制各种组成、实现技术的采用和发展,尽量做

文档评论(0)

_______ +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档